AIHA Announces IH Professional Pathways Program

The program encourages and supports earning credentials for IH professionals.

The American Industrial Hygiene Association announced a new program for industrial hygienists called the IH Professional Pathways Program. Announced during the AIHA Fall Conference in Orlando, the program was created due to a desire to align resources and development opportunities with the various career stages of the profession. The program will encourage and support those who earn credentials within the industry.

"IH Professional Pathways will bring great value to our members by helping align our conferences, courses, and publications with the needs of industrial hygienists, EHS technicians, and allied professionals," said Steven E. Lacey, Ph.D., CIH, CSP, AIHA's president-elect.

An infographic called Career Stages was developed to promote the program, describing knowledge areas that are key for every IH professional.
